磁致伸缩

磁致伸缩效应(英语:magnetostrictive effect)指的是对软磁体进行磁化后,其形状、大小会发生变化的物理现象,该现象在19世纪中叶被人们发现。磁致伸缩现象具有各向异性。当长度为l的磁性材料在磁化方向上的长度变化为Δl时,磁致伸缩率可表示为:λ=Δl/l[1]。由于磁致伸缩率一般在10-5以下,所以对磁致伸缩效应的应用远不如对压电效应的应用广泛。到20世纪60、70年代后,发现了伸缩率在10-3的超磁致伸缩材料。磁致伸缩效应才重新受到重视。
